I have a favor to ask. I have been quoted from a local shop (Note not my shop) on a new camper shell. If anyone has gotten a price quote in their area for the same would you please share the price you were quoted. Here is what I was quoted.
-Leer 100XQ, 09+ Ram 1500 short-bed, CC painted to match with black liner
$2418.00
-Leer front slider window
$75.00
-Leer/Thule Rack Aero Upgrade
$455.00
-Three way 12V power block
$75.00
-Leer Keyless Entry Access
$195.00
-Leer Gear Net
$75.00
-Bedrug
$549.00

Grand Total $3,842.00

They said if I let them sponsor me and allow a huge sticker from their shop they would knock of $300 off the price. That is only if I agree to attend 5 of the auto shows this summer.

What is everyones thoughts? I think it's very expensive but it is the top of the line stuff.

That's about a buck fifty too high on the bed rug, unless that includes installation. It's only 488 installed here at the local dodge dealership.

Also, there is no way I'd agree to be at 5 shows AND a big sticker for only 300 bucks. It'd be more like 150-200 per show and 500 at least for the sticker. I hate stickers, and my time is way more valuable than they think it is. You figure 5 shows at 6 hrs per show, they are only giving you 10 bucks an hr, and that don't include fuel to get there and back.

I would also think you could put your own 12v power supply in it for way less than 75 bucks.

The best option is to sit back and look for a while. Many people take them off for what ever reason and never put them back on. With a little time and some luck, you will find one for sale on craigslist (or somewhere). I scored the exact type that I wanted for my '01 long bed. They were asking $300 obo. I got it for $150, spent another $150 for matching paint and done.
